Finding a Window Replacement Company Near Me

Windows are an integral component of a house's aesthetics and level of comfort. Inefficient, ugly, or damaged windows can lower the curb appeal of a home and increase the cost of energy.

The homeowners should research window replacement companies and choose one that offers top-rated products and services. Comparing warranties, prices, and types of windows can assist them in determining the best fit for their home.

Costs

When planning the cost of window replacement homeowners should take into consideration the style and the material of their windows. There are other aspects that impact the cost, such as whether they want energy-efficient windows, specific window treatments, and more. The more customizations that a homeowner wants to make, the higher their cost.

Retrofit installations can reduce the cost of window replacements for homeowners by using existing frames and trims instead of having to replace them. This option is not recommended for older homes, or ones that have extensive damage to their frames and trim. To determine the exact cost homeowners should talk to a local window expert.

The decision to buy new windows is a significant investment for a homeowner, and many are worried about the cost of installation. A professional window pro can help homeowners understand the cost of their choices and assist them in making the most appropriate choices to fit their budget. For instance, they can explain the difference between a single- or double-pane glass window. Single-pane windows let sunlight flow through the window while preventing heat from escaping during the winter. Double-pane windows on the other hand, prevent air leaks, reducing cooling and heating costs by as much as 40 percent.

The type of frame you choose can also affect the price of the project. Aluminum frames can run from $75 to $400 per window. Wood is more expensive, but more durable than aluminum. Vinyl frames are cheap and easy to maintain, however they do not insulate as well as other materials. Composite frames, which blend wood fibers with polymers in order to give the strength of wood, without the need for maintenance is among the most durable and energy-efficient alternatives, priced between $700 and $1200 for a window.

Homeowners can cut costs by tackling certain upvc repairs near me themselves for example, fixing broken latches or screens. However, they should delegate larger jobs, such as fixing a window that is difficult to open or has a frayed frame that is leaky, to professionals. A pro can also help save money by advising them to purchase energy efficient windows, which cost more, but can help them reduce their utility costs by as much as 30 percent.

Installation

A reputable window replacement company can help you select windows that complement your home and fit your budget. They can also assist with the installation process. They will take down and clean the old window. They can also replace screens and trim and install replacement doors. These services are available for new construction projects and retrofits.

Windows last for an average of 20-30 years. They are supposed to protect you from cold and hot temperatures. Eventually, they will begin to deteriorate and their function could be lost. This can lead to drafts and expensive energy bills. You should think about replacing your windows if they show signs of wear or not effective in making noise less and reducing energy costs.

In addition to having a license (if required), a window repair and replacement service should be insured. This will safeguard you in case there are any damage during the installation process. They should provide a guarantee for their products and their labor. A window installer should be able to explain the process of installing new windows and give you a thorough project plan and timetable. They should also provide information on the different types of windows and the different materials so that you can pick the right option for your home.

During the consultation An experienced and knowledgeable contractor will answer all of your questions. They will also draft an estimate and provide you with a detailed estimate of the project's costs. They will help you decide whether you want to do a full-frame window replacement or a retrofit installation. A full-frame window replacement requires removal of the entire frame as well as the sash of the window while a retrofit installation only replaces the sash.

A reputable window replacement company will work with reputable manufactures and provide a range of options that match your style, budget, and needs. Choose a company with windows that are energy efficient, with enhanced UV protection and design flexibility. They will also be able to offer you financing options and extended warranties.
